Just wanted to post a message on the board about a left handed pitcher from Lake Brantley HS in Orlando area. Ryan Markell is currently a freshman, vying for a spot on the varsity team in the spring. He was a member of the 2001 U.S. Little League champs. He is currently throwing his fastball in the low to mid 80's and is working on an improving change up. He possess a great amount of poise and command on the mound. Has anyone seen him pitch?
